Accolade for enterprising Neil

A SUCCESSFUL South Tyneside businessman was honoured by his former university last night.

Neil Stephenson is chief executive officer (CEO) of the Onyx Group, one of the UK's top technology solutions providers, which employs 100 staff.

Mr Stephenson, from South Shields, was awarded the prestigious Alumni

Enterprise Award by the University of Sunderland, where he studied for a degree in electronics and computing between 1990 and 1993.

The 37-year-old enjoyed a rapid ascent with Onyx after joining as sales and marketing director, progressing to CEO and spearheading a period of rapid growth, helping quadruple the group's turnover from 3m to 12m in just two years.

Mr Stephenson, speaking at the Blueprint Business Planning Awards ceremony, said: "I am delighted to have received recognition for my achievements at the Onyx Group, and it is a pleasure to return to the University of Sunderland to receive this award."

The Onyx Group also has offices in Tyneside and Teesside, Gateshead and Newcastle.
